Jul. 31, 2023
WILLIAMSPORT – Rep. Jamie Flick (R- Lycoming/Union) released the following statement on the Biden Administration’s decision to withhold funding for schools with hunting and archery programs.
“The Biden Administration’s recent decision that schools providing hunting and archery classes cannot receive federal funding is an egregious attack on education, sporting activities and the culture of the 83rd district and regions like it.
“As many of us know, hunting plays an incredibly important and regulated role in the safety and health of our Commonwealth’s ecosystems. Additionally, hunting programs are a great way for youth to learn responsibility and get involved in their communities.
“I would like to see the school districts in our region work closely with the Pennsylvania Game Commission and the House Game and Fisheries Committee, to which I was recently assigned, and get more involved with hunter safety courses. This decision stands in the way of that.
“An important part of hunting is learning the role it plays in our Commonwealth and the many safety guidelines that must be followed. This decision will strip children of this educational opportunity that helps students practice hunting safely and effectively. For these reasons and as a lifelong hunter and member of the House Game and Fisheries Committee, I strongly oppose the Biden Administration’s decision.”
